revolver

Cart
PlaceholderWalther Arms PPS M2 LE EDITION 9MM 3.18" 6/7/8+1
$283.10
×
Ruger GP100 .22 LR 5.5 Adjustable Sights WD/SS
$634.60
×
What Our Clients Say
83738 reviews